Transaction 7b425786707b22f7f34656a61790dbef758755edb76f3a3e24d3ff4b63f48544
2 Input
2 Outputs
- 7b425786707b22f7f34656a61790dbef758755edb76f3a3e24d3ff4b63f48544:0
- 7b425786707b22f7f34656a61790dbef758755edb76f3a3e24d3ff4b63f48544:1
value 675318
address 1HWqsgnSd12Gv8SpoUMi1Cj8hp79BTSpW7
value 89800000
address 15Xf2dCGhZtyA8a2CuwUK3wyN1rCsTKJZU